Sarah – profile of an artist
Life is art. Reality seared into dreams. For Sarah Johnstone life began sweetly with a Forres upbringing that lead to art studies in Liverpool and a BA in Design Practice specialising in Fashion at Salford. However, life also has a much darker side that reveals its true nature. Sarah’s art tracks the course of a happy, if spirited, childhood through a shattered and reconstructed existence from which she has wrestled back control to discover and rediscover important truths. The deaths of a child and a fiancée, separation, family sickness, alienation and ill health have provided the counterpoint of ten traumatic years. Reassessing a whole way of thinking, being able to believe in survival and discussing the real meaning of friends and friendship have resulted in a restored sense of pride, vision about what exists without and within, determination and renewed ability to turn inner feelings into positive expressions. This is Sarah’s contemporary hallmark. “I’m lucky I’m creative,” she says. “I’m lucky I can use art to vent and turn my feelings into something that I think is visually beautiful, striking and powerful.” Her work is impressive, collectable, memorable and combines the art of seduction with the abstract and dramatic. Her goal is to empower people, lift their day, emphasise and give them something fine and positive to remember. Both masculine and feminine Sarah's work is dark & demanding but with the power of her somewhat childlike naivity at play, it shows her honesty & depth of character. The cryptic nature of her work entices you to decipher and discover your own interpretations while it may be obvious as a picture, her message is there to be found by your own feelings. For Sarah, art is her life – plus the love of her two daughters, without whom she says, she would no longer draw breath.
